Fort Strength 08.01.2021

The Fort is a community, a community that was brought together by the love of CrossFit, but has become bigger than that. It’s what we do, it’s how we train, and that will never change. We strive to bring people together, without judgement and being all inclusive, to make us all excel and to be better. One man and his comment won’t change our community. Together we’ve be representing the CrossFit brand for 19+ years, and our future solely depends on HQ’s actions moving for...ward. We’ve waited a couple days to get the facts and let this all set in, and if there is no drastic change that happens, we will NOT re-affiliate. We will not support the CrossFit brand, if this problem persists. We don’t stand for what CEO Greg Glassman has done or said, and we won’t tolerate it. We need to speak up so that we aren’t part of the problem. We don’t fully understand, so we’ve waited to see how HQ will rectify this problem and make it right. We are learning and getting the facts to move forward. Glassman is one man, and together we are bigger. We want this to be about change and making people better and more aware, let’s see how he can change, and how HQ can make him and this situation forgivable. The thing we’ve always loved most about CrossFit is how it brings everyone together. All levels of ability, all races, all genders, all backgrounds...we come together as one, train as one, and always support one another. We are the Fort, so regardless of what happens, we love you all and are extremely thankful and grateful for each and everyone one of you that make us so strong. See more

We are welcoming a lot of new things at the Fort, first up is Katy Clark: Katy Clark has been passionate about athletics her entire life. She’s been an avid lacrosse player for over 16 years, which helped lead her to a career in Kinesiology. Since studying at the University of the Fraser Valley for her bachelors degree in Kinesiology, Katy has gained a vast knowledge of functional movement, sports injury rehabilitation, ICBC car accidents, and strength and conditioning. She has worked as the Head Trainer of a local men’s Rugby league for three years, and has also trained hockey and lacrosse teams in the past. She is so excited to be a part of the Fort Strength team.
